Transaction 6424d51d65bcc64103d6f33fede76b028b5091a504da35aa8d08440dc577d38e

1 Input
2 Outputs
  • 6424d51d65bcc64103d6f33fede76b028b5091a504da35aa8d08440dc577d38e:0
  • value  7523425
    address  bc1qq7ud8x46hcedr5h9k24q2hddqndqtv8fg9ncay
  • 6424d51d65bcc64103d6f33fede76b028b5091a504da35aa8d08440dc577d38e:1
  • value  175200
    address  17HsK6k5uMtVJYaNeP6RZYLVRmCQBBi3zt